Our company and what we do

At Trilateral Research we provide ethical AI solutions for tackling complex social issues, from human trafficking and child exploitation, citizen security in crisis to pollution and climate change. We transform research into innovation and sustainable impact​, focusing our efforts where we can enhance societal wellbeing.


Our products help users make decisions when tackling complex social challenges such as protecting civilians during crisis, preventing child exploitation and modern slavery. What are your responsibilities?

  • Guide the company in production-ready data science components within our products, with a focus on explainable AI.
  • Actively support strategic product definition and identification of the role and opportunity of ethical AI and its realisation at the product and business level. Challenging perspectives where required.
  • Actively support in identifying ethical AI innovation strategic priorities and team-wide implementation of strategic priorities in collaboration with business and product management.
  • Actively lead a product team incl. ML-Ops – ensuring timely and quality-assured innovation and development in line with strategic objectives
  • Actively lead DS support to product implementation and ongoing support meeting customer requirements for pilots and/or production systems
  • Actively lead in team-wide implementation of standards and operational procedures
  • Sign-off development/ innovation conceptualisation and technical contributions to innovation proposals and business development in-line with business objectives
  • Design, plan and implement technical tasks and documentation in-line with product objectives
  • Provide line management to no more than 5 members of staff including active management of the full employee life cycle & performance management in line with company values
  • Support internal training and development of data science expertise across the team.
  • Demonstrate expertise through collaborative peer-reviewed, publication and/or conference papers and wider marketing collateral (e.g., blogs, webinars, podcasts) – working across the team as required.

Requirements

What skills and experience you will bring to the role


Interpersonal Skills:

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Willingness to learn, knowledge share, coach others and improve
  • Experience in line management and supporting professional development of others
  • Experience in working at a strategic level with senior management (business & technical)
  • Disposition to remain calm under pressure, with a proactive approach to problem solving and risk management


General Knowledge and Technical Skills:

  • Excellent organizational skills, including ability to prioritise in an agile and confident manner
  • Proven design and delivery of data science initiatives, including ideation, discovery, evaluation and iteration, and deployment with live software products
  • Ability to translate business and customer requirements into data science solutions, including identifying areas where data science can add high value
  • Good understanding of statistics - hypothesis testing, p-values, confidence intervals, regression, classification, and optimization.
  • Strong algorithmic probl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to design and implement user-friendly and maintainable APIs
  • Experience manipulating large data sets (structured and unstructured data) through statistical software or other methods
  • Experience delivering NLP projects from ideation, through discovery, iterative development, evaluation, and deployment into working software and/or products.
  • Excellent technical skills – Python, SQL, ElasticSearch, Neo4J, pandas, scikit-learn, Keras, PyTorch, etc.
  • Experience with natural language processing – Topic modelling, Word2Vec, Transformers
  • Ability and willingness to use and learn new technologies
  • Demonstrable experience and interest in the realization of ethical AI

Required Education and Experience:

  • 5+ years’ experience in data science inclusive of commercial SaaS experience (Essential).
  • Experience taking data science initiatives from discovery through development to successful product deployment (Essential).
  • Masters/PhD in Physics, Computer Science, Mathematics, Data Science, or related subject (Desirable)
  • Experience in ML-Ops (Desirable)
  • Experience with relevant AWS services (Desirable)
  • Experience working in a start-up environment (Desirable)
  • Demonstrable desire and motivation to solve complex challenges under conditions of uncertainty (Desirable)
